This webinar will explore strategies for gathering input and feedback from current and potential stakeholders as well as explore how partnerships can be developed to attract new audiences. Participants will hear how the Southold Historical Museum used a survey to gather stakeholder input and thought strategically about the strategies, time, and effort needed to build mutually beneficial and trusting relationships with new partners and stakeholders. It will further share how the New York State Canal Corporation (NYSCC) and the Erie Canal Museum (ECM) are partnering to attract new audiences to the Erie Canal through new research on the untold stories of the Canal, public art, and the highlighting of Canal infrastructure.
